Milan Star Not Going to Leave Despite Barcelona Chatter

Recent rumors from Spain suggested Barcelona was keen on Rafael Leao and was preparing an offer, but Milan have every intention of keeping their ace, especially with so little time left in the transfer market window, Gianluca Di Marzio reports.

The winger had a €175M release clause early in the summer, but no side came close to activating it. The Rossoneri could have perhaps agreed to his sale in recent weeks for a mammoth fee, but that’s no longer the case.

While nothing will happen with Leao, Barcelona could sign a different Serie A star, Federico Chiesa. They are in touch with his agent Fali Ramadani. They’ll have to shake hands with a player first. Other sides have had big trouble achieving that. The deal could happen without makeweights.

Per Tuttomercatoweb, the Blaugrana would have let the Rossoneri choose one or more players in their roster in exchange for the Portuguese. The options would have been Raphinha, Andreas Christensen, Inigo Martinez, Ferran Torres, and Alejandro Balde. Some of them would have had to be convinced to leave Catalunya. The Spanish team doesn’t have the resources for a very pricey acquisition for now. They’d have to sell one or more among Ansu Fati, Ronald Araujo, and Frenkie De Jong to build their budget.

Our Take on Barcelona and Leao

It’d be a stunner if something occurred this late, and it most likely won’t. The Chiesa transfer is a lot more likely as the Bianconeri would settle for a small sum or a not-so-shiny player in return.
